Warning messages
If messages appear on the screen, check the following. See the page in parentheses
“( )” for details.
• CLOCK SET Set the date and time (p. 31).
• FOR ”InfoLITHIUM” Use an “InfoLITHIUM” battery pack (p. 273).
BATTERY ONLY
• CLEANING CASSETTE The video heads are dirty (p. 280).
The x indicator and “ CLEANING CASSETTE“ message appear
one after another on the screen.
• COPY INHIBIT You tried to record a picture that has a copyright control signal
(p. 270).*
• FULL The Cassette Memory is full.*
• 16BIT AUDIO MODE is set to 16BIT. You cannot dub new sound
(p. 231).*
• REC MODE REC MODE is set to LP.* You cannot dub new sound (p. 231).
You cannot dub new sound on the tape recorded in a TV colour
system other than that of your camcorder.
• TAPE There is no recorded portion on the tape.* You cannot dub new
sound.
• ”i.LINK” CABLE The i.LINK cable is connected. You cannot dub new sound
(p. 119).*
• FULL The “Memory Stick” is full (p. 145).*

• NO FILE No image is recorded or there is no recognizable file on the
“Memory Stick”.*
• NO MEMORY STICK No “Memory Stick” is inserted.*
• AUDIO ERROR You are trying to record an image with sound that cannot be
recorded by your camcorder on the “Memory Stick” (p. 163).*
• MEMORY STICK ERROR The “Memory Stick” data is corrupted (p. 137).*
• FORMAT ERROR The “Memory Stick” is not recognised (p. 229).*
Check the format.
• PLAY ERROR The image is distorted and cannot be played back.*
Reinsert the “Memory Stick.”
• REC ERROR Turn the POWER switch on again.*
• INCOMPATIBLE The “Memory Stick” inserted is not compatible
MEMORY STICK with your camcorder.*
• READ-ONLY MEMORY STICK A read-only “Memory Stick” is inserted.*
• Q Z TAPE END The tape has reached the end of the tape.*
• Q NO TAPE Insert a cassette.*
* You hear the melody or beep sound.
